For this cake, I use a two layers of 12" round cake. I frosted it with uncolored buttercream and made the lid green using this technique from the
gift box cake tutorial.
I then chilled the cake after the lid was made.
I made a bow from brown fondant the night before making the cake.
Using different sizes of round cutters, cut out some circles from brown and blue fondant. Place on the "lid" part of the cake.
Place the fondant bow on the top center of the cake. Using green buttercream, pipe out some broken line to look like stitches on the bow using tip # 1.
Make a border with petal tip # 104 using a conitnuous "U" motion. Pipe a bead boder on top of the ruffles using round tip #10.
Roll some brown fondant thin and cut out a plaque. Pipe some "stitches" on the plaque and write the greeting.
